OverviewThe AACE/ACE Diabetes Algorithm for Glycemic Control PocketGuide[trademark] is endorsed by the American Association of Clinical Endocrinologists and the American College of Endocrinology. This practical quick-reference tool contains oral and insulin drug therapy and dosing information. It provides all that is needed to make accurate treatment decisions at the point of care according to the latest consensus recommendations, including a comprehensive medication risk/benefit table, the current AACE/ACE diabetes algorithm for glycemic control, and a summary of insulin types and regimens. Applications include point-of-care, education, QI interventions, clinical trials, medical reference, and clinical research. The American College of Endocrinology was established in 1993 as a nonprofit, 501(c)(3) organization. It was established as the educational and scientific arm of the American Association of Clinical Endocrinologists (AACE), and is dedicated to promoting the art and science of clinical endocrinology for the improvement of patient care and public health.
